Steps to recover photos on Android system

"Google Photos" in the Android application to store the photos taken from the cell phone.

one-. On your Android device, you will find a storage house called “Google Photos”. Enter there.

two-. Upon entering, press the bottom that says “Library”, then press “Trash”.

3-. You will find recently deleted items. Touch, pressing for several minutes, the one you want to recover. When doing so, you will see that an options menu is displayed, touch the one that says "Restore".

4-. Instantly, the photo will appear in your gallery again.

5-. If when entering the “Trash” the document you want to restore is not there, you may have deleted it permanently.

If the photo was permanently deleted, you can no longer recover it. It is important that you know that when you delete a material, you can recover it before 30 days. If a file remains in the trash for more than 30 days, it will automatically be deleted.

If you empty the trash after deleting an item, the photo will disappear so I don't have the 30 days that are set. For this reason, you must be very attentive and always check your trash to avoid losses that you will later regret.

Steps to recover photos on an IOS system

"Photos" is the IOS application to store the images.

The IOS system encompasses everything we know as iPod or iPhone. Surely you have wondered, how to recover deleted photos on these devices? Do not despair, this option was recently incorporated with its exceptions.

Here we explain in very simple steps how to achieve that immediate recovery:

  1. Go to the “Photos” app. Tap the "Albums" tab, which appears at the bottom of the screen.

  2. Now, access the section called "Deleted", which appears last, generally, in many models.

  3. In this section, the documents deleted in a period of 30 days appear. Open the photo you want to recover, when doing so, in the lower right corner it will give you the option to “Recover”.

  4. Now, you will have the image available in the reel that corresponds to it according to the date of its creation.

Using “previous versions”

Windows has a section known as "Previous Versions", this is based on being able to access a file that you have recently changed. To recover deleted photos using this option, what you should do is the following:

  1. Go to the folder where the photos you already deleted were.

  2. Right click somewhere in the folder, by doing so, a menu of options will appear, click the section that says "Restore previous versions".

  3. When doing so, the list of files that you can recover will appear, select the ones you want and that's it.

  4. To make sure that it is the correct file, you can click on the “open” option, there you can quickly view it and then click on the “restore” option. The photo will appear in the folder to which it previously belonged.

Using a backup

Usually, Windows system has the option to back up your files by creating a backup of each of them. To recover deleted photos using this option, what you should do is the following:

  • Look for a backup that you made before deleting the photos.

  • Try accessing the option to restore from a backup.

  • To do this, connect the “File History” drive and follow the steps:

    one-. Go to the "Start" section.

    two-. Type “Restore Files”.

    3-. Click “Restore Files” using File History.

    4-. Choose the folder of photos you want to access again.

    5-. Select the time when the folder had these photos.

    6-. Click on the “Restore” option.
